After you rent your car and before you charge off on your road trip to Cancun, Acapulco or Los Cabos, there are a few things you need to consider about taking a rental car to Mexico. Even if you plan to stay in the Border Zone, which is about 12 – 20 miles from the U.S. border for only 72 hours or less, you need automobile insurance that is valid in Mexico. If you would like to drive to many of the beautiful sites in Mexico, you will need Mexico travel insurance and a temporary permit for your car.

Types of Insurance
Travel insurance for Mexico covers several parts of your trip. Whether it is a medical emergency, a change in plans or your carrier cancels your flight, you do not need to be the loser. You can have travel medical insurance that is from International Medical Group so you are confident that you can trust the health care providers. Your short-term coverage will last for the duration of your travel. If you need to change your plans and cancel a flight, trip cancellation insurance will cover your expenses.
